WARNING
When using the NE-224S Sub-dermal Straight Needle Electrode
• Do not use the NE-224S sub-dermal straight needle electrode as a
measurement electrode for the EEG or evoked potential
measurement for any longer than one hour.  When measuring the
EEG or evoked potential for over one hour, use the EEG disk
electrode.
• Do not check the skin-electrode impedance when using a needle
electrode or intracranial electrode.  Failure to follow this warning
injures the patient because these electrodes will be damaged by
electrolyzation inside the body.
• When measuring the patient with the implantable pacemaker, leave
the instrument (telemetry unit and access point) more than 22 cm
from the patient.  Otherwise, the radio wave from the telemetry unit
or access point may interfere with the pacemaker.
• Do not delete any system file in the hard disk of the
electroencephalograph.  Otherwise the system may malfunction.
• Periodically back up the EEG data files to prevent loss of data if the
hard disk or MO disk is damaged.
